What is the main purpose of balance in design?
Back
To create a sense of harmony
Answer explanation
The main purpose of balance in design is to create a sense of harmony. It ensures that elements are arranged in a way that feels visually stable and cohesive, rather than making them look identical or limiting the types of elements used.

What happens when too many elements are placed on one side of a design?
Back
It becomes unbalanced.
Answer explanation
When too many elements are placed on one side of a design, it becomes unbalanced. This imbalance can disrupt the visual harmony and make the design feel awkward or heavy on one side.

What can rough vs. smooth textures create?
Back
Contrast
Answer explanation
Rough and smooth textures create contrast by highlighting differences in surface qualities. This contrast can enhance visual interest and depth in design, making it the correct answer.

What is the impact of including different style shapes and forms?
Back
Creates contrast
Answer explanation
Including different style shapes and forms creates contrast, which enhances visual interest and emphasizes differences in design elements. This contrast can make a design more dynamic and engaging.

What is the purpose of emphasis in design?
Back
To highlight the most important information
Answer explanation
The purpose of emphasis in design is to highlight the most important information, guiding the viewer's attention to key elements and ensuring effective communication of the message.

What effect does singling out one object from a group have in design?
Back
It creates emphasis
Answer explanation
Singling out one object from a group creates emphasis, drawing attention to it and highlighting its importance in the design. This technique enhances visual interest and focus, making the design more effective.

How does hierarchy control the viewer's experience?
Back
By controlling the order of information consumption
Answer explanation
Hierarchy controls the viewer's experience by determining the sequence in which information is presented. This influences how effectively the viewer processes and understands the content, making the correct choice 'By controlling the order of information consumption'.
